Insulin resistance and thyroid disorders.

Insulin resistance, a disorder of glucose homeostasis, affects tissues like muscle and liver. Thyroid disease significantly impacts carbohydrate metabolism, influencing insulin resistance severity and location.
Area of Science:
- Endocrinology
- Metabolic Disorders
Background:
- Insulin resistance is a key factor in glucose homeostasis disruption, linked to conditions like type 2 diabetes and obesity.
- It involves decreased tissue sensitivity to insulin, despite normal or high blood insulin levels.
- Mechanisms include pre-receptor, receptor, and post-receptor defects, with assessment relying on glucose and insulin measurements.
Purpose of the Study:
- To explore the relationship between thyroid disease and insulin resistance.
- To understand how hyperthyroidism and hypothyroidism affect glucose metabolism and insulin sensitivity.
Main Methods:
- Assessment of insulin resistance using concurrent blood glucose and insulin measurements.
- Utilizing the metabolic clamp technique as the gold standard for measuring tissue glucose utilization.
- Analyzing carbohydrate metabolism in patients with overt and subclinical thyroid dysfunction.
Main Results:
- Thyroid disease, both hyperthyroidism and hypothyroidism, is associated with carbohydrate metabolism disorders.
- The severity of thyroid disease correlates with the severity of glucose metabolism disturbances.
- Hyperthyroidism predominantly causes hepatic insulin resistance, while hypothyroidism is linked to peripheral insulin resistance.
Conclusions:
- Thyroid hormones play a crucial role in modulating glucose metabolism and insulin resistance.
- Understanding the specific impact of hyperthyroidism and hypothyroidism on insulin resistance is vital for managing metabolic health.
- Further research is needed to clarify the influence of subclinical thyroid dysfunction on carbohydrate disorders.
